This episode decodes the strategic advantages 9-figure omnichannel brands, like Ilia Beauty, wield over nascent startups. It illuminates how established brands master various sales channels and leverage a unified brand message to drive sustainable growth, offering crucial lessons for scaling DTC businesses beyond initial traction.
Key takeaways
Omnichannel success hinges on deep channel expertise, not just presence. Brands must understand the nuances of each platform, from Amazon to Sephora, to effectively engage customers and manage inventory.
A unified brand message across all touchpoints — online, social, and in-store — is critical for building trust and recognition, especially as brands scale into new retail environments.
For startups, identifying and focusing on one or two dominant channels initially can build a strong foundation before expanding into a full omnichannel strategy.
Effective inventory management and forecasting become exponentially more complex and crucial in an omnichannel model; sophisticated systems and strategies are essential to avoid stockouts or overstock.
Leveraging physical retail spaces, even through pop-ups or limited partnerships, can significantly boost brand visibility and customer acquisition beyond digital channels alone.
